Salmo gairdneri

Definitions

from Wiktionary, Creative Commons Attribution/Share-Alike License.

  • proper noun A taxonomic species within the genus Salmo — the rainbow trout.

  • As one example, for most of the twentieth century the rainbow trout was known as “Salmo gairdneri,” but it is now known as Oncorhynchus mykiss.

    Trout and Salmon of North America Robert J. Behnke 2002
